Madonna Returns with Bunny Ears for LV campaign

Madonna looks just as comfortable sprawled amidst lush draperies as she does in a Parisian café. Where she silently smoldered in the latter for Louis Vuitton Spring/Summer 2009, this time Madonna returns wide-eyed and bunny ear-ed for the Fall/Winter advertising campaign.

The holy trinity of the French fashion house- Marc Jacobs as artistic director, Steven Meisel as photographer and Madonna as model and muse- relocated to a New York studio for the shoot.

Each portrait-like photograph mirrors the aristocracy of the golden age of Hollywood, a fitting backdrop to showcase the ruffles, sequins, silks and all-over extravagance of Marc Jacob’s ready-to-wear collection for Louis Vuitton.

Inspiration was drawn from other celebrated artists- the rich colour palette reminiscent of a Tamara de Lempicka painting glimmers ethereally with help from Man Ray’s solarization techniques.

The Louis Vuitton Fall/Winter 2009-2010 advertising campaign will break in the August 2009 issues of magazines worldwide.
